Village Overview

Dharwas (11) is a village in Pangi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Chamba district, Himachal Pradesh. For Dharwas (11), the population is 718, PIN code is 176323 and Census village code is 6675. Location and Administration

Dharwas (11) comes under Dharwas (11) gram panchayat and Pangi C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Pangi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Kilar at 13 km. The Census district headquarters, Chamba, is 180 km away.

Population Profile

The population details below are from Census 2011 village records. They help you understand the size of Dharwas (11) village and its household count.

Total population

718 residents in 129 households

Male population

351

Female population

367

SC/ST population

Scheduled Castes: 11; Scheduled Tribes: 686

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Dharwas (11)
Net area sown48.64 hectares
Irrigated area18.56 hectares
Unirrigated area30.08 hectares
Forest area107.76 hectares
Non-agricultural area0.54 hectares
Main cropWheat
Second cropBarley
Third cropMaize
